Output 7d83f950db33bc2cd63b97510c728e40df4ce7f4f89bf33d2e2ba1bb76d2e4a2: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9adf58d99e25ce0f31f6e4dba907d724a588d367 OP_EQUAL
address
3FouYWf9zuo5x5v1enEZeRqgDjD6CMmZyb
transaction
7d83f950db33bc2cd63b97510c728e40df4ce7f4f89bf33d2e2ba1bb76d2e4a2
confirmations
284970
spent
true